
Colorado, anchored by the significant urban area of Colorado Springs, presents a unique operational environment for garage door systems due to its high altitude and semi-arid climate. The state experiences dramatic temperature fluctuations, intense solar radiation, and significant snowfall in many regions, all of which demand robust and resilient garage door solutions.
The extreme diurnal temperature variations common in Colorado can cause rapid expansion and contraction of garage door materials, potentially leading to stress on hinges, rollers, and tracks, and affecting the precise calibration required for optimal Genie opener function. High altitude also means increased UV exposure, which can degrade non-resistant materials over time, necessitating the use of UV-stabilized finishes and components. Furthermore, the significant snowfall in many parts of the state requires robust sealing to prevent moisture ingress and operational interference from ice buildup. When selecting a provider in Colorado, it is crucial to seek expertise in handling these specific environmental factors, including recommendations for materials that resist UV damage and thermal stress, and ensuring the Genie opener is properly calibrated for altitude-related air pressure changes.
In Colorado, the most frequent garage door repair often involves addressing issues with torsion springs, which are highly susceptible to stress from the significant diurnal temperature variations and freeze-thaw cycles. This directly impacts the balance of the door and the smooth operation of the Genie opener.
A common problem in Colorado Springs' garage doors is the degradation of seals due to intense UV exposure and temperature fluctuations, leading to reduced insulation and potential moisture ingress. This can also affect the performance of the Genie opener by allowing dust and debris entry.
